54 /*
55  * WARNING: The legacy I/O space is _architected_.  Platforms are
56  * expected to follow this architected model (see Section 10.7 in the
57  * IA-64 Architecture Software Developer's Manual).  Unfortunately,
58  * some broken machines do not follow that model, which is why we have
59  * to make the inX/outX operations part of the machine vector.
60  * Platform designers should follow the architected model whenever
61  * possible.
